Role
* Line Manager for all PMs within the Line of Business (LoB)
* Support the prioritisation and delivery of Projects within the Line of Business to enable delivery of forecast
* Ensure projects are delivered on time, on cost and on quality
* Provide P3M best practice in project end to end lifecycle within the portfolio of projects in the line of business
* Support the creation of LoB Integrated Project Teams (IPTs) enabling end to end delivery of projects
* Keep the LoB Leadership and other key stakeholders appraised of risks, issues and mitigations, escalating appropriately for support
* Ensure project safety and compliance to applicable laws and regulations (e.g. CE/UKCA)
* To own transformation and continuous improvements activities for the Projects full business life-cycle
* Deliver cost and risk estimates (i.e. BAFs) to support Business Winning activity

Security
Due to the nature of this position, we require you to be eligible to achieve SC as a minimum and in some cases DV clearance may be required. As a result, you should be a British Citizen and have resided in the UK for the last 5 years for SC and 10 years for DV.
